Shagreen is skin of...

Shagreen is skin of

A

Cod fish

B

Sole fish

C

Shark

D

Whale

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
**Step-by-Step Solution:** 1. **Understanding Shagreen**: Begin by defining what shagreen is. Shagreen is a type of skin that is known for being rough and untanned. 2. **Identifying the Source**: Recognize that shagreen comes from cartilaginous fish. Cartilaginous fish are characterized by having a skeleton made of cartilage rather than bone. 3. **Determining the Correct Fish**: Among the options provided (cod fish, sole fish, shark, and whale), identify which of these is a cartilaginous fish. The shark is a well-known example of a cartilaginous fish. 4. **Evaluating the Options**: - **Cod Fish**: This is a bony fish and does not produce shagreen. - **Sole Fish**: Also a bony fish, known as flatfish, and does not produce shagreen. - **Shark**: This is a cartilaginous fish and is the source of shagreen. - **Whale**: This is a mammal and does not produce shagreen. 5. **Conclusion**: Based on the analysis, the correct answer is that shagreen is the skin of the shark. **Final Answer**: Shagreen is the skin of the shark. ---
